Behavioral By the end of the lesson, pupils will be able to:
objectives (a) Able to read and answer at least 3 out of 5
comprehension questions correctly based on the text.
(b) (i) Able to read and fill in the blanks with at least 4 out
of 5 uses of the Internet correctly. ( above average and
average proficiency)
(ii) Able to read and fil in the blanks with at least 4 out
of 5 uses of the Internet correctly based on the
guidance given. ( below average proficiency)

Language Content Vocabulary : invented, collection, huge, search


The uses of Internet :
1. To search for information
2. To play games
3. To send emails
4. To chat
5. To make video and video calls
6. To shop online
